67 Commits

Author SHA1 Message Date
Zoe Roux
b340958348
Add login route 2024-10-19 18:09:21 +02:00
Zoe Roux
4685f76cad
Go mod tidy 2024-10-19 18:09:21 +02:00
Zoe Roux
dd1580b819
Fix timestamptz typo 2024-10-19 18:09:21 +02:00
Zoe Roux
dc41880ca7
Fix pgx configuration 2024-10-19 18:09:21 +02:00
Zoe Roux
0c64d9b15d
Add dockerfile 2024-10-19 18:09:21 +02:00
Zoe Roux
cf1e7497e2
Add swagger and problem details 2024-10-19 18:09:21 +02:00
Zoe Roux
8a2fb36cb0
Setup sessions 2024-10-19 18:09:21 +02:00
Zoe Roux
306dbbd024
Create register 2024-10-19 18:09:21 +02:00
Zoe Roux
dfc411e5f6
Add configuration table 2024-10-19 18:09:20 +02:00
Zoe Roux
d285603716
Register wip 2024-10-19 18:08:33 +02:00
Zoe Roux
db08bb12c8
Register wip 2024-10-19 18:08:33 +02:00
Zoe Roux
b20c6c30ff
Move users.go 2024-10-19 18:08:33 +02:00
Zoe Roux
d820a1b149
Setup validators 2024-10-19 18:08:33 +02:00
Zoe Roux
6b55ae6395
Fix queries 2024-10-19 18:08:33 +02:00
Zoe Roux
606332ba6f
Add list users route & split oidc to a new table 2024-10-19 18:08:33 +02:00
Zoe Roux
629660bb79
Init user database 2024-10-19 18:08:33 +02:00
Zoe Roux
73e3c6c64b
Add auth spec 2024-10-19 18:08:33 +02:00